KS3 Comprehension - Frankenstein

This three-lesson mini-unit is designed to help Year 9 learners develop their comprehension skills with an eye towards GCSE. It is made up of a 51-slide PowerPoint presentation, worksheets and a comprehension test using an extract from Frankenstein.

Contents:

Lesson One

  • An introduction to comprehension at upper KS3 and GCSE

  • How to approach a comprehension task (the dos and don’ts)

  • Approaching an extract - first and second reading

  • Understanding unfamiliar vocabulary, narrative consolidation and using deduction skills

  • How to write an extended answer about language and the writer’s use of techniques

Lesson Two

  • How to refer to the text and use quotes effectively

  • How to write an extended answer about structure

  • A 45-minute comprehension task

Lesson Three

  • Feedback on pupil responses to the tasks and discussion of success criteria

  • All five comprehension questions and answers explored in detail

  • Exemplar answers for all five questions
